Output 8111a71b44efd3c3916ac89bf5bab65beba62e26f5c123ada74b6cee6fcc685b:16

value
1095000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ac4a0f8fe72364d11d6d403c4d8cd3e8ff9a5a9 OP_EQUAL
address
3QYxQWXPC6J5EtgqCXsbXYzd3geVztBEPj
transaction
8111a71b44efd3c3916ac89bf5bab65beba62e26f5c123ada74b6cee6fcc685b
spent
true